Should walk 30 minutes everyday enough?

Walking for 30 minutes every day can be a good starting point for many people to improve their overall health and well-being. Regular physical activity, including walking, offers a wide range of health benefits, such as:

  1. Cardiovascular Health: Walking helps improve heart health by increasing circulation, reducing blood pressure, and lowering cholesterol levels.
  2. Weight Management: Regular walking, especially when combined with a balanced diet, can contribute to weight loss or weight maintenance.
  3. Mood Enhancement: Exercise, including walking, stimulates the release of endorphins, which can help reduce stress and improve mood.
  4. Improved Sleep: Regular physical activity can help you fall asleep faster and make your sleep more profound.
  5. Increased Energy Levels: Walking boosts circulation and oxygen supply to cells, helping you feel more energized.
  6. Joint Health: Walking is low-impact and easy on the joints, making it accessible to people of different fitness levels and ages.

However, whether 30 minutes of walking every day is “enough” depends on your specific health goals and circumstances. The American Heart Association recommends at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ic activity per week for adults. This translates to about 30 minutes a day, five days a week.

If your goal is to maintain general health and well-being, 30 minutes of walking every day can be a suitable and sustainable routine. However, if you have specific fitness goals (such as significant weight loss or building endurance), you might need to adjust the duration and intensity of your exercise routine in consultation with a fitness professional or healthcare provider.

Remember that it’s also important to balance exercise with other aspects of a healthy lifestyle, including a nutritious diet, sufficient sleep, and stress management. Additionally, if you have any health concerns or conditions, it’s advisable to consult a healthcare provider before starting a new exercise program.
